Effect of Anchorage Exposed to Fire on Thermal and Structural Response of Prestressed Anchorage Systems
In order to research effect of unsealed anchorage under fire exposure on fire resistance of prestressed concrete beams and slabs, a prestressed anchorage system is designed, which composed by JXM-clip anchor age, high strength φ7 steel bar for PC (with a characteristic strength fptk =800 MPa) with surrounding con crete and loading frame.Results from fire resistance experiments on 23 prestressed anchorage systems are presented in this paper.The test variables included stress level (the ratio of effective stress tofptk from 0.2 to 0.7) of steel bar for PC, temperature of anchorage (200 ~ 800 ℃) and heating rate (10 and 26.7 ℃/min).Data from the experiments is utilized to study the effect of critical parameters on fire re sponse of prestressed anchorage systems.Test results show that temperature and stress level have significant influence on fire resistance and failure mode of prestressed anchorage system.The steel bar for PC slipped from anchorages during fire.Factors governing failure mode of prestressed anchorage systems is discussed.The lower the stress level, temperature and heating rate, the higher will be the fire resistance in prestressed anchorage systems.
